Transaction 6533389e53c3023bb6add1253e46fe7d6a9f454cb3acc8f29992fb4c16326281
1 Input
1 Output
-
6533389e53c3023bb6add1253e46fe7d6a9f454cb3acc8f29992fb4c16326281:0
- value
- 1783417
- script pubkey
- OP_0 OP_PUSHBYTES_20 9ed758f7e4113154cc76bba1542289d13895e58b
- address
- bc1qnmt43alyzyc4fnrkhws4gg5f6yuftevtr9qpvh